Transaction 81aba6626d15edf76acd1508555c9af7559b4f4293c612143005422577663aa2
1 Input
1 Output
-
81aba6626d15edf76acd1508555c9af7559b4f4293c612143005422577663aa2:0
- value
- 4999752
- script pubkey
- OP_0 OP_PUSHBYTES_20 1eda2bc3ab7d3714954f25580717f495190f6954
- address
- bc1qrmdzhsat05m3f920y4vqw9l5j5vs7625hkf0cm